BMO Bank of Montreal's “Night at the Gallery” Contest in Full Swing for the Vancouver Art Gallery's Monet to Dali Summer Blockbuster Exhibition

BMO Bank of Montreal is currently running a random-draw contest for a “Night at the Gallery” featuring a private tour, dinner and children's art workshops at the Vancouver Art Gallery's summer blockbuster exhibit, Monet to Dali.

The contest runs from mid-July to mid-August in all 61 BMO Bank of Montreal full service branches within Greater Vancouver. There will also be a ballot box in front of the Vancouver Art Gallery at the ‘BMO Live at the Gallery' free outdoor concerts, which are part of Festival Vancouver's noon hour concerts – August 7-9.

Winning families with be the guests of BMO Bank of Montreal and the Vancouver Art Gallery at an exclusive and interactive evening with dinner in the Gallery Caf�, private viewings of the Monet to Dali exhibition, and fun filled art workshops on Wednesday, August 29th, 2007.

WHEN:

Contest closes on Monday, August 20th, 2007 for the “Night at the Gallery” event taking place on Wednesday, August 29th.
WHAT: Each of the 61 BMO branches will select one winner (a family of four) to receive the grand prize of attending the “Night at the Gallery” event. As many as 248 people will have the gallery to themselves for this private tour, dinner and art workshops.
WHERE: Contest running at BMO Bank of Montreal branches. The “Night at the Gallery” will be held at the Vancouver Art Gallery, 750 Hornby Street

BMO Financial Group is a major supporter to arts and culture in Canada and in Greater Vancouver. BMO is a sponsor of the Vancouver Art Gallery, which is currently running the Monet to Dali exhibit representing the most comprehensive showing of European painting and sculpture in Vancouver in more than half a century. Drawn from the superb collections of the Cleveland Museum of Art, the exhibition consists of more than 80 paintings, drawings and sculpture that demonstrate key examples from the European modernist movement.
